Output f45b31d58439f20b51136b38a8239c39e3346fa050c424b539cbca7e780ee44a:0

value
618600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7507b5cc3c61839458797b0e43e05a18d3bf7b04 OP_EQUAL
address
3CMpDhTYbr6oujTGnsAQWTkgdQMrmcYKRS
transaction
f45b31d58439f20b51136b38a8239c39e3346fa050c424b539cbca7e780ee44a
spent
true